“Snow Dogs” is the oldest kennel of northern sled dogs in Kamchatka. It is the brainchild of the famous Kamchatka mushers – Andrey and Anastasia Semashkin and their nine children. Their family has been participating and winning the world’s longest dog sled race “Beringia” for over 10 years. Anya Semashkina is the youngest musher in Russia.
